lynnm Posted December 4, 2001 Share Posted December 4, 2001 Here is a description lifted from the "Tweeter" site: The two 8" Cerametallic woofer cones are lighter, stronger and better damped than commonly used cone materials. Cerametallic is a specially treated aluminum that has been anodized, or electro-chemically transformed into ceramic on both outer surfaces. Similar to the motor of the large compression driver, powerful, video-shielded 28oz. magnets drive these woofers allowing for precise signal tracking without blurring the sound.
